THE STORY OF A HUNDRED YEARS OF COMBAT FLIGHT

Great Book of Combat Aircraft begins with the origins of military aviation, complete with vintage photos of pilots and machines of a bygone era. It traces the evolution of these devastating works of technology, with sections on the rise of the bomber, the birth of the monoplane, and the role of electronics and missiles.

As the story unfurls, it reveals the dramatic events of past and recent conflicts fought in the skies, over land and sea, covering everything from the First World War to the Cold War. Here, you’ll discover the fiercest aircraft from the United States, Russia, Germany, Italy, Japan, and beyond.

This fully illustrated book ends with a look toward the future in terms of both aircraft and strategy. In the hands of a single military leader, these sophisticated weapons can be as powerful as an entire army would have been in the past.

About the Author


PAOLO MATRICARDI is an aviation journalist who lives and works in Rome. He has written many books on aviation that have been translated into other languages and distributed in Europe, the United States, and Japan. Among these, in collaboration with Enzo Angelucci, is the series World Aircraft, 1918–1935 (7 volumes); World Aircraft: Combat Aircraft, 1945–1960; the two volumes World Aircraft: Commercial Aircraft, 1935–1960, and The Illustrated Encyclopaedia of Military Aircraft: 1914 to the Present; and the series of large format illustrated books dedicated to the aircraft of the Second World War. His recent works are the two volumes Fighters and Bombers and 100 Years of Aviation: A History of Humankind’s Conquest of the Skies, the story of the first century of powered aircraft.
